Gulls Can’t Solve San Jose, Fall 4-0
Mar 19, 2025
By Nick Aguilera/SanDiegoGulls.com
It wasn’t the start to the road trip the San Diego Gulls wanted, as they fell 4-0 to the San Jose Barracuda Wednesday morning at Tech CU Arena.
Despite the setback, the Gulls still hold an 11-5-1-1 record since the AHL All-Star break and sit nine points out of the final playoff position in the Pacific Division.
Oscar Dansk kept the score respectable, as the veteran netminder stopped 32 shots in the contest. The game also saw the Gulls debut of forward Carsen Twarynski, who was acquired last week from the Abbotsford Canucks.
The Gulls will now head to Henderson for a pair of matchups with the Silver Knights at Lee’s Family Forum beginning Friday night (6 p.m. PDT).
